Chat

Sometimes a client needs help of a real employee. Chat component allows you to start a live dialogue.
You can only communicate with clients through Dialogs section. To open the dialogue history and start a conversation with a client, click on it in the list.
1. Создайте новый экран и добавьте на него компонент Чат.
2. Добавьте переход с существующего экрана на экран с чатом.
3. Настройте компонент Чат:
  • В поле Текст перед переводом на оператора напишите сообщение, которое отправится клиенту с началом чата.
  • В поле Экран после завершения диалога укажите экран, который исполнится, если клиент выйдет из чата самостоятельно.
  • В поле Причина обращения пользователя укажите тему обращения. Это поле особенно полезно, если вы используете чат в разных сценариях, и тема обращения может отличаться.
  • С помощью функции Язык компонента можно изменить язык, на котором придёт кнопка завершения чата, или текст с командой для завершения.
4. Сохраните проект.
5. В разделе Настройки перейдите к настройкам Чата:
  • Укажите Текст, который будет отправлен пользователю при подключении оператора. Если оставить пустым, то по умолчанию пользователю будет присылаться текст Отправьте СТОП, чтобы закончить разговор с оператором.
  • Укажите Текст на кнопке завершения диалога. Если оставить пустым, то по умолчанию на кнопке будет выводиться текст Завершить чат.
  • Укажите Текст, который будет отправлен пользователю при отключении оператора в Telegram и Facebook. Текст будет приходить пользователю, если не задан экран перехода после чата.
  • Выберите Экран, на который будет переведен пользователь после завершения диалога со стороны менеджера. Если выбран экран, то текст при завершении диалога не придет.
6. Сохраните изменения.
Important! To avoid missing messages, use Alert component to add notifications about the start of the chat.